Understanding Precision Farming Systems
Precision farming is a modern agricultural management concept that utilizes detailed data, advanced analytics, and technology such as GPS and IoT to monitor and manage field variability in crops. It aims to tailor agricultural inputs like water, fertilizers, and pesticides specifically to the needs of different areas within a field, rather than applying a uniform treatment. This approach not only improves crop yields but also enhances resource efficiency and reduces environmental impact.
The Role of Micronutrients in Crop Health
Micronutrients, though required by plants in trace amounts, are crucial for their development, metabolic functions, and overall health. Deficiencies can lead to reduced growth, poor yield quality, and increased vulnerability to diseases. Traditionally, broad-spectrum fertilizers were used, but these often fail to address specific micronutrient needs, especially in soils with imbalanced nutrient profiles.
Magnesium Sulphate: A Vital Micronutrient
Magnesium sulphate stands out as a dual-action micronutrient: it supplies magnesium and sulfur, both essential for plant growth. Magnesium is a core component of chlorophyll, the molecule responsible for photosynthesis, directly influencing the plant's ability to produce food energy. Sulfur, on the other hand, plays a key role in protein synthesis and enzyme function.
In many agricultural soils, magnesium and sulfur deficiencies frequently occur, especially in intensive cropping systems or acidic soils prone to nutrient leaching. The application of magnesium sulphate not only corrects these deficiencies but also enhances nutrient uptake and improves overall plant vigor.
Specialty Micronutrient Blends: Precision in Nutrient Delivery
Emerging specialty micronutrient blends incorporate magnesium sulphate in carefully calibrated ratios alongside other essential micronutrients like zinc, iron, manganese, and copper. These blends are designed based on soil testing and crop-specific nutrient requirements, ensuring that plants receive the precise nutrient balance they need.
The formulation of these blends takes into account the interactions between different micronutrients and how they influence plant metabolism. For example, magnesium enhances phosphorus utilization, while sulfur can boost nitrogen assimilation. By delivering these nutrients in a balanced blend, specialty fertilizers promote optimal plant growth and resilience.
Targeting Yield Optimization Through Precision Nutrition
The adoption of specialty micronutrient blends aligned with precision farming technologies enables a more nuanced nutrient management strategy. Real-time soil and plant health monitoring tools provide insights into nutrient status and deficiencies, allowing farmers to adjust fertilizer applications dynamically.
This targeted approach minimizes nutrient wastage and environmental runoff while maximizing crop uptake. The result is a consistent improvement in crop yield quantity and quality. Moreover, healthier plants are better equipped to resist pests, diseases, and environmental stresses, contributing to stable and sustainable production systems.
Advantages of Using Magnesium Sulphate Based Specialty Blends
- Enhanced Photosynthesis and Growth: Magnesium's role in chlorophyll production directly supports robust photosynthesis, leading to vigorous plant growth.
- Improved Protein and Enzyme Function: Sulfur ensures important metabolic processes function optimally, enhancing crop development.
- Balanced Nutrient Uptake: Combined micronutrients correct deficiencies and improve the plant's ability to absorb macronutrients.
- Increased Stress Tolerance: Adequate nutrition fortifies plants against drought, temperature fluctuations, and pathogen attacks.
- Environmental Sustainability: Precision application reduces excess fertilizer use, cutting down on nutrient leaching and environmental contamination.
